Richard Terry, DO, MBA, is an established and highly skilled osteopathic physician who has been practicing both rural and urban family medicine in the NY region for over 20 years. He is well regarded nationally for his efforts in osteopathic medicine, his innovativeness in graduate medical education, and his large body of research.

Dr. Terry brought his wealth of knowledge to LECOM, first serving as the Assistant Dean of Regional Clinical Education, the Chief Academic Officer of the Lake Erie Consortium for Osteopathic Medical Training (LECOMT), and now serving as the founding Associate Dean of Academic Affairs at LECOM at Elmira.

Dr. Terry also served as the inaugural Designated Institutional Official at Arnot Ogden Medical Center in Elmira, NY from 2012-2019, where he initiated nine ACGME-accredited programs to support 126 residents and fellows.
